| // This tablegen backend emits an fficient function to translate HTML named
 | |
| // character references to UTF-8 sequences.
 | |
| //
 | |
| //===----------------------------------------------------------------------===//
 | |
| 
 | |
| #include "llvm/ADT/SmallString.h"
 | |
| #include "llvm/Support/ConvertUTF.h"
 | |
| #include "llvm/TableGen/Error.h"
 | |
| #include "llvm/TableGen/Record.h"
 | |
| #include "llvm/TableGen/StringMatcher.h"
 | |
| #include "llvm/TableGen/TableGenBackend.h"
 | |
| #include <vector>
 | |
| 
 | |
| using namespace llvm;
 | |
| 
 | |
| /// \brief Convert a code point to the corresponding UTF-8 sequence represented
 | |
| /// as a C string literal.
 | |
| ///
 | |
| /// \returns true on success.
 | |
| static bool translateCodePointToUTF8(unsigned CodePoint,
 | |
|                                      SmallVectorImpl<char> &CLiteral) {
 | |
|   char Translated[UNI_MAX_UTF8_BYTES_PER_CODE_POINT];
 | |
|   char *TranslatedPtr = Translated;
 | |
|   if (!ConvertCodePointToUTF8(CodePoint, TranslatedPtr))
 | |
|     return false;
 | |
| 
 | |
|   StringRef UTF8(Translated, TranslatedPtr - Translated);
 | |
| 
 | |
|   raw_svector_ostream OS(CLiteral);
 | |
|   OS << "\"";
 | |
|   for (size_t i = 0, e = UTF8.size(); i != e; ++i) {
 | |
|     OS << "\\x";
 | |
|     OS.write_hex(static_cast<unsigned char>(UTF8[i]));
 | |
|   }
 | |
|   OS << "\"";
 | |
| 
 | |
|   return true;
 | |
| }
